Military analysts point to the unique vulnerability of British assets in the region. Unlike the massive U.S. airbases that are designed for sustained combat and high-level defensive saturation, British facilities—such as those in Bahrain, Oman, and Cyprus—often serve as logistical hubs, intelligence outposts, and training centers. They are vital, yet they lack the sheer ballistic shield that defines the larger American installations. This makes them attractive targets for a "hybrid warfare" approach: a strike that does not necessarily aim to destroy a facility, but rather to humiliate the British military and force a political crisis in London.

The role of regional proxies adds another layer of complexity to this narrative. It is rarely the Iranian Revolutionary Guard Corps (IRGC) operating in a vacuum. Instead, they rely on a network of non-state actors, ranging from militias in Iraq to insurgent groups in Yemen. These groups offer Tehran a degree of "plausible deniability." If a drone or a missile hits a British base, the regime in Tehran can claim it was the work of an independent actor acting out of nationalist fervor. This tactic is well-documented, but the international community is becoming increasingly impatient with it. London has signaled, in no uncertain terms, that the distinction between Iranian-directed actions and Iranian-backed actions is fading in terms of the consequence they will face.

British bases operate in foreign sovereign territory, meaning that any defensive measures must be coordinated with the host government. This creates layers of bureaucratic red tape at a moment when speed is of the essence. If a base commander in Oman believes that a drone swarm is imminent, they must navigate a complex chain of command that involves local authorities, regional partners, and the Ministry of Defense in Whitehall. The potential for miscommunication is high, and the danger of an accidental escalation is a constant concern for military planners.

For a heavy cargo aircraft descending toward a major international hub, wet weather introduces an immediate and dangerous variable: hydroplaning. When a layer of water builds up between the tires of an aircraft and the runway surface, braking efficiency drops dramatically, transforming concrete into something resembling polished ice.

In aviation, the go-around is the ultimate safety valve. It is an established procedure where pilots who realize a landing is unstable, too fast, or misaligned abandon the attempt, power up their engines, and climb back into the safety of the sky to circle around and try again. While executing a go-around burns extra fuel and disrupts scheduling, failing to execute one when parameters are dangerously out of bounds can spell disaster.
